Show Youth Council Elects Youth Council officers of the local M. E. Community church were elected at a business meeting meet-ing held in the church Thursday evening, January 18, as follows: President, Charles Fisher; first vice-president, devotional life,! Harry (Mack) Meeker; second vice-president, missionary edufca-tion edufca-tion and stewardship, Ruth Gress-man; Gress-man; third vice-president, soSial service, Eunia O'Rear; fourth vice-president, recreation and culture, cul-ture, Esther Crawford; chairman of camp services, Roy Anderson; secretary and reporter, Barbara Gressman; treasurer, Edwin Verke; Sunday school, Co-WorW-er's class president, ex-officio, George Broschat. These officers met Sunday, January 21, and appointed the following additional officers: usher, Walter Barnett; pianist, Julia Hendrickson; chorister, Roy Shultz; counselor, Lucille E;4tes; program co-ordinator, Zella Rice. The entire cabinet will be installed install-ed at a beautiful consecration service ser-vice at 7:30 p.m. Sunday. This will take the place of the regular j preaching service. Everyone in-viud. |
